1
0
Fork 0
luxonis-cruft/start-stream.sh

28 lines
494 B
Bash

#!/bin/bash
echo "Should make sure nothing is running..."
echo "Takes 2+ minutes to start"
date
sleep 1
echo "Remove old buffer files"
rm video.h265 video.mkv
echo "Start encoding..."
./rgb_encoding.py &
sleep 30
echo "Encode to Matroska"
ffmpeg -framerate 30 -loglevel quiet -i video.h265 video.mkv &
sleep 60
echo "Serve Matroksa stream"
while true ; do sleep 1; ../mkvserver_mk2/server video.mkv 1>/dev/null 2>/dev/null ; done &
echo "View stream at:"
echo "http://127.0.0.1:8080"